You may find yourself asking the questions like, “how much is my land worth today,” “how much is … Weblake, stream, or wetland the stormwater runoff from your property drains to these water sources. Even if you don’t live close to a wetland, creek or pond, the runoff from your property enters concrete pipes and likely travels only as far as the nearest body of water. Therefore, it is important to take special care to keep your stormwater clean.

WebIf your property is in a low area, has standing water for part of the year, and has common wetland plants such as cattails, reed canary grass, sedges, alder, or willow, you likely have wetlands. Be aware that areas that are dry most of the time may still be wetlands.
